git客户端基本操作

一 远程文件拉取和推送
git  init       #初始化
git   add  .  #添加文件到暂存区
git  commit  -m  "提交"           #提交到主分支
git  remote  add  origin  http://xxxxx   #添加远程仓库
git  push  -u  origin  master    #推送到远程

git  fetch  origin                    #拉取远程
git  merge  origin/master      #合并本地和远程
git  push  -u  origin  master   #推送远程

二 创建远程分支提交远程分支

git  init
git remote  add origin  http://xxxxx #添加远程仓库
git  checkout  -b  test            #创建一个本地test分支
git  add  .                        #分支文件提交暂存区
git  commit -m "测试"               #提交分支文件
git  branch                        #查看分支 及当前分支
git  push origin  test:test        #把本地创建的test分支推送到远程 ouyang分支
#在github上merge  然后删除
git push  orgin  --delete   test   #删除远程分支

三 git合并分支远程分支

git clone https://xxxxx                                              #克隆clone
git checkout -b dev origin/dev                                  #本地创建dev分支并与远程dev分支对应
git  checkout  master                                                #合并后切换到master分支
git  merge  dev  -allow-unrelated-histories                #合并分支
git  push origin  master                                             #推送到远程
git push  orgin  --delete   dev                                    #删除远程分支

其它

git branch  #查看分支
git status  #查看状态
git checkout  -b  test #创建一个test分支本地
git push origin  test:ouyang   #把本地创建的test分支推送到远程 ouyang分支
git branch -u  origin/dev   dev   #将本地dev和远程仓库origin/dev连接起来   git  branch  -u  远程分支   本地分支
git push  orgin  --delete   ouyang  #删除远程分支
-allow-unrelated-histories  #参数用来处理一些报错  fatal: refusing to merge unrelated histories
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值